> My Pfsense firewall has 3 interfaces, WAN, LAN and DMZ. Mac
> OS computers in my LAN net can not connect to an external
> site on net. When I sniff the traffic on both WAN and LAN
> interfaces I saw a situation like this:
> 
> MAC -> LAN -> WAN -> SITE (SYN)
> SITE -> WAN x LAN x MAC (SYN ACK)
> 
> I see SYN ACK packages on my WAN interface coming from SITE
> but I don't see them on my LAN interface. Packages getting
> lost between my WAN and LAN interfaces. Is there any way to
> debug the problem? / Is there any one having the same
> problem?
